Aprenda a criar uma aplicação FULLSTACK usando Next.js, Node.js, Tailwind e MYSQL – Parte 1
Se você está interessado em aprender a criar uma aplicação fullstack utilizando Next.js, Node.js, Tailwind e MYSQL, então está no lugar certo. Neste artigo, vamos abordar os conceitos básicos e a configuração inicial para começar a desenvolver a sua aplicação.
Next.js
Next.js é um framework de desenvolvimento web front-end que é utilizado para criar aplicações web de forma eficiente e fácil. Ele possui suporte para server-side rendering, geração de páginas estáticas e um sistema de roteamento simplificado.
Node.js
Node.js é uma plataforma construída sobre o motor JavaScript V8 do Google Chrome para fácil criação de aplicações de rede rápidas e escaláveis. Ele é muito utilizado no desenvolvimento de aplicações web e fornece um ambiente de execução para o JavaScript no lado do servidor.
Tailwind
Tailwind é um framework de CSS que permite a criação de estilos de forma simples e eficiente. Ele oferece uma abordagem de utilitários para a criação de estilos, o que permite um maior controle e flexibilidade na estilização dos elementos da aplicação.
MYSQL
MYSQL é um sistema de gerenciamento de banco de dados relacional de código aberto. Ele é amplamente utilizado em aplicações web para armazenar e gerenciar dados de forma eficiente e segura.
Configuração inicial
Para começar a desenvolver a sua aplicação, é necessário realizar a instalação e configuração das ferramentas necessárias. Siga as instruções abaixo para configurar o ambiente de desenvolvimento:
- Instale o Node.js e o NPM (Node Package Manager) em seu computador.
- Crie um novo projeto Next.js utilizando o comando `npx create-next-app`.
- Instale o Tailwind CSS em seu projeto utilizando o comando `npm install tailwindcss`. Em seguida, execute o comando `npx tailwindcss init` para criar o arquivo de configuração do Tailwind.
- Instale o MYSQL em seu computador e crie um novo banco de dados para a aplicação.
Agora que o ambiente de desenvolvimento está configurado, você está pronto para começar a desenvolver a sua aplicação fullstack. Fique atento para a parte 2 deste artigo, onde iremos abordar a criação do servidor utilizando Node.js e a integração com o banco de dados MYSQL.
Parabéns! Vídeo de excelente conteúdo uma pena que estava com muita dificuldade para ouvir, espero que no próximo vídeo o som esteja melhor de qualquer forma muito obrigado.
Vídeo sensacional! Parabéns!!
video mt bom